Crynodeb: | Interview conducted for Dorothy Day : portraits by those who knew her. Carl and Mary Paulson describe what drew them to the Catholic Worker, meeting Dorothy Day and each other, and converting to catholicism. Mary also shares stories of traveling with Ade Bethune making art and crafts, and Carl discusses his arrest and jail time for draft resistance during World War II. Interviewed by Rosalie G. Riegle. Interruptions in audio present in original recording. |
